      Stockport vs Lincoln City Predictions

      Stockport to extend strong home record

      Stockport have been strong at home this season, and they should be backed to get a victory over Lincoln on Saturday. Dave Challinor’s side have triumphed in 15 of their 22 home games in League One, while Lincoln have won six times on the road.

      Stockport are fifth in League One and certain of a play-off spot, six places and 20 points above Lincoln, with 23 wins from their 44 games this season.

      Stockport beat Huddersfield 2-1 on Monday to justify their price of 4/5 and keep up their recent winning trend. However, they conceded the opening goal for the third game running and have won just three of the 16 games this season in which they’ve shipped first (19%).

      Stockport are hitting their stride at home. They have won eight of their last nine League One games at their ground and come into this match on the back of four consecutive victories.

      It would be no surprise to see Stockport score, as they have found the net in seven of their last eight league games, scoring at least twice in five of those matches.

      The visitors have looked vulnerable in defence. Lincoln have failed to keep a clean sheet in four of their last six League One games.

      There have been over 2.5 goals in four of Stockport’s last six League One matches and, while they may be able to edge out Lincoln in a close game, a 2-1 home win is the correct-score pick. Eleven of Lincoln’s 15 League One reverses this season have been by a single goal.
